Kinds Of Doors Available for Installation
Choosing the ideal door is important for both function and looks. Below are some popular types of doors:
Type of Door | Description | Perfect Use |
---|---|---|
Panel Doors | Standard doors with panels raised or recessed. | Living areas, bed rooms, restrooms |
Flush Doors | Smooth-surfaced doors without panels. | Interior spaces, restrooms |
French Doors | Double doors that open from the center. | Patios, dining rooms |
Sliding Doors | Doors that move along a track. | Patios, closets |

Entry Doors | Front doors developed for security and curb appeal. | Main entrance |
Elements to Consider When Installing a Door
- Material: Wood, fiberglass, steel, or composite-- each material has its benefits and drawbacks.
- Style: Ensure that the door aligns with your existing home decoration.
- Functionality: Consider the primary function of the door (privacy, looks, insulation).
- Energy Efficiency: Choose insulated doors for better energy preservation.
- Weather condition Resistance: In environments with severe weather condition, more powerful materials may be necessary.
The Door Installation Process
1. Measuring the Door Frame
Before you select a replacement door, accurate measurements of the existing frame are important. This action prevents any size mismatches and makes sure an appropriate fit.
2. Selecting the New Door
After measurements have been taken, the next step involves selecting the right kind of door. House owners should think about the aforementioned elements of material, style, and functionality.
3. Preparing the Frame
This stage may include getting rid of the old door and any existing hardware such as hinges and doorknobs. If the frame appears harmed, repairs might be essential before fitting the new door.
4. Setting Up the New Door
Once the frame has been prepped:
- Attach Hinges: The new door hinges should be attached initially to the door itself.
- Hang the Door: Position the door into the frame and change it for level.
- Install Hardware: Attach the doorknob and any locks.
5. Sealing and Finishing
Include weather condition removing and other sealing materials to make sure an airtight fit. Finally, finish with paint or stain as preferred.

Expenses Associated with Door Installation
The cost of door installation can differ considerably based upon several aspects including:
- Door Type and Material: Premium products will usually cost more.
- Labor: Hiring a professional installer includes to the total cost.
- Location: Costs might vary depending on your geographical location.
Average Cost Breakdown
Cost Component | Average Price |
---|---|
Door (Material Costs) | ₤ 100 - ₤ 1,500 |
Labor (Installation) | 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 per hour |
Additional Hardware | ₤ 20 - ₤ 200 (differs) |
Total Estimated Cost | ₤ 300 - ₤ 2,000 or more |
